Randomized Controlled Trial Comparative Study Clinical TrialA double-blind comparison of morphine infusion and patient controlled analgesia in children.
The analgesia provided after major abdominal surgery in 30 children by continuous morphine infusion and patient controlled analgesia, also using morphine, was compared using a double-blind, double-dummy design. The groups of children were comparable in age, weight, duration of operation and sex ratio. ⋯ Children aged between nine and 15 years achieved better pain relief with patient controlled analgesia. No difference could be shown in children aged between five and eight years.

ReviewAcute respiratory distress syndrome (ARDS) in neonates and children.
ARDS remains a syndrome which despite all efforts poses problems in exact definition (cause, course and severity). Most of the existing information comes from clinical observations and uncontrolled studies and is therefore of limited value. ⋯ With the introduction of gentler respiratory support techniques (small tidal volumes and pressure limitation, permissive hypercapnia and HFO) and appropriate measures to reduce oxygen toxicity (titration of PEEP, possibly NO), iatrogenic lung injury, indistinguishable from ARDS, can be reduced, and this might improve survival rates. For the future, modulation of the host's inflammatory response may hold great promises for prevention and treatment of ARDS, but such strategies need to be explored with well controlled clinical trials, respecting the complexity of the issue.

Case Reports Randomized Controlled Trial Clinical TrialMidazolam following open heart surgery in children: haemodynamic effects of a loading dose.
Our objective was to establish the safety and effectiveness of a loading dose of midazolam for postoperative sedation of children recovering from open heart surgery; a prospective randomized placebo-controlled double-blind study was done with subjects randomized to three groups according to loading dose. I = 0.08 mg.kg-1; II = 0.04 mg.kg-1; and III = 0.00 mg.kg-1 (placebo). An open label continuous midazolam infusion protocol followed. ⋯ One subject in Group I (the 23rd) became hypotensive within five min of receiving the loading dose, had a difficult clinical course and died four weeks postoperatively. We cannot conclude that the loading dose of midazolam had any systematic haemodynamic effect in our study population. Although the clinical course of the 23rd subject suggests a subset of more susceptible children (those who receive opioid analgesia with midazolam, are volume-restricted, and/or undergo more complex forms of surgical correction), many critical care patients are inherently physiologically unstable, and concluding clinically that blood pressure fluctuation is drug related may be erroneous.

Randomized Controlled Trial Comparative Study Clinical TrialComparison of 25 G and 29 G Quincke spinal needles in paediatric day case surgery. A prospective randomized study of the puncture characteristics, success rate and postoperative complaints.
A comparison of a 25 G with a 29 G Quincke needle was performed in paediatric day case surgery. Sixty healthy children aged 1 year to 13 years were randomly allocated to have spinal anaesthesia with either 25 G or 29 G Quincke needle without an introducer needle. There was a failure rate of 10% with the 29 G spinal needle compared with 0% with the 25 G needle. ⋯ In conclusion, lumbar puncture without introducer needle was possible with both needles. The puncture characteristics favoured the 25 G needle. A shorter needle could partly alleviate the difficulties with the 29 G needle.

Infants with Beckwith-Wiedemann syndrome usually present different abnormalities which may require surgical correction. Anaesthetic management may be complicated by abnormal airway anatomy, congenital heart disease and severe hypoglycaemia. Careful preoperative evaluation, perioperative monitoring and suitable choice of anaesthetic technique are required for a successful outcome. We report the perioperative management of a patient with Beckwith-Wiedemann syndrome presenting for omphalocoele surgery on his first day of life and for bilateral inguinal hernia repair four months later.
